The Nonprofit Ecosystem in Carpinteria

Carpinteria is home to 102 nonprofit organizations. In aggregate, these organizations account for $86m in revenue and employ 849 individuals.

California Avocado Festival Inc

Carpinteria, CA

Assets: $16k

Revenue: $34k

MISSION:

TO CONDUCT AN ANNUAL FESTIVAL FOR THE ENJOYMENT OF LOCAL RESIDENTS AND BUSINESSES, AS WELL AS TOURISTS IN ORDER TO PROMOTE THE AVOCADO AGRICULTURAL INDUSTRY, TO PROVIDE THE FUNDING OF SPONSORSHIPS TO SUPPORT LOCAL COMMUNITY PROJECTS AND THE DEVELOPMENT OF TOURISM WITHIN THE CARPINTERIA VALLEY.
